    If you are in La Conner Hellam's is a must stop if you enjoy tasting wines. They offer wines from across Washington state plus beyond. The tasting fee is a dollar per taste, which I would more than likely have left as a tip. There are multiple over stuffed chairs and couches to linger in longer if you are so inclinded.

    What a wonderful store. Wine tastings are only $1.00 each. Jeffrey, the owner is very knowledgeable about wines of the world. Wine prices are very reasonable. He also has an arrangement with some local restaurants that won't charge a corkage fee if you show them a receipt from a wine purchase in his store.

    Really fun little spot to sit and sample wines on the water. It's only $5 to sample 8 of their wines and you can sit out on the deck and watch the boats go by. We ordered the cracker and cheese plate which was also very good and a perfect addition to the experience. If you feel like spending a day on the water and drinking wine, this is the place to go.
